The rapidly evolving landscape of healthcare technology presents exciting opportunities for enhancing patient care. This article highlights some of the most promising emerging technologies set to revolutionize healthcare practices.
AI and ML are poised to transform healthcare through predictive analytics, personalized medicine, and improved diagnostics. These technologies can analyze vast amounts of data to identify patterns, predict patient outcomes, and tailor treatments. Furthermore, AI can assist in early disease detection, potentially improving prognosis and reducing healthcare costs.
Telemedicine allows healthcare professionals to deliver care remotely, improving access for patients in rural or underserved areas. This technology has been particularly beneficial during the COVID-19 pandemic, enabling safe and efficient patient care. Future developments in telemedicine may include remote patient monitoring and virtual reality applications, further enhancing patient engagement and outcomes.
Wearable devices, such as fitness trackers and smartwatches, are increasingly being used in healthcare to monitor vital signs and track patient behavior. These devices generate real-time data that can be used to manage chronic conditions, promote healthy lifestyles, and even predict potential health issues.
3D printing has the potential to revolutionize healthcare by enabling the production of customized medical devices, prosthetics, and implants. This technology can also be used to create patient-specific models for surgical planning, improving outcomes and reducing surgical risks.
From AI and ML to telemedicine, wearable technology, and 3D printing, emerging technologies are set to significantly impact healthcare practices. As these technologies continue to evolve, healthcare professionals must stay informed and adapt to leverage these tools effectively. The future of healthcare is here, and it promises to be transformative.
